Slow Cooker Green Chili Pork Stew

4 servings
Prep 10 min • Cook 4 hr • Total 4 hr 10 min • 317 cal
Ingredients
- pork tenderloin 2 pounds
- ½ teaspoons kosher salt 1 unit
- olive oil spray 0 unit
- olive oil 1 teaspoon
- all-purpose flour 2 tbsp
- ¾ cup diced onion 0 unit
- jalapeño 2 tbsp
- 4.25-oz cans whole green chiles 2 unit
- can diced tomatoes and green chilies 10 oz
- ⅓ cup low-sodium chicken broth (or bone broth) 0 unit
- cumin 1 tablespoon
- ½ teaspoon garlic powder 0 unit
Steps
- Cut pork into 2-inch pieces. Season with salt and pepper.
- Heat a large non-stick skillet on high heat; when hot lightly spray the pan with oil and brown the pork over medium heat on all sides, about 3 - 4 minutes total.
- Sprinkle 1 tbsp of flour over pork and stir to cook 30 seconds, sprinkle remaining flour over pork and cook an additional 30 seconds. Transfer the browned pork to the slow cooker
- Add oil the the skillet and saute the onion and jalapeno, until soft, 3 to 4 minutes. Transfer to the slow cooker along with the remaining ingredients.
- Cook on LOW for 6 to 8 hours or HIGH for 4 hours, until tender.
- When done, adjust salt and pepper to taste as needed.
